Piet A. Kager is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Epidemiology and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Piet A. Kager has authored 115 papers receiving a total of 4.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 80 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, 26 papers in Epidemiology and 21 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health. Recurrent topics in Piet A. Kager's work include Malaria Research and Control (71 papers), Mosquito-borne diseases and control (29 papers) and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(16 papers). Piet A. Kager is often cited by papers focused on Malaria Research and Control (71 papers), Mosquito-borne diseases and control (29 papers) and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(16 papers). Piet A. Kager collaborates with scholars based in Netherlands, Kenya and United States. Piet A. Kager's co-authors include Feiko O. ter Kuile, Anna Maria van Eijk, Peter J. de Vries, Bernard L. Nahlen, John Ayisi, Richard W. Steketee, Henk D. F. H. Schallig, Ambrose Misore, Trần Quang Bình and Pètra F. Mens and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, American Journal of Clinical Nutrition and Clinical Infectious Diseases.
